💡
原文英文,约500词,阅读约需2分钟。
📝
内容提要
本文讨论了网页开发中的可访问性问题,特别是元素的可访问名称。介绍了可访问名称的定义、检查方法和计算方式,同时提及了相关规范和资源。
🎯
关键要点
- 本文讨论网页开发中的可访问性问题,特别是元素的可访问名称。
- 可访问名称为辅助技术用户提供元素的上下文和目的。
- 检查元素的可访问名称可以通过浏览器的开发者工具进行。
- 所有可聚焦的交互元素都必须具有可访问名称,包括链接、按钮、对话框和某些结构容器。
- 可访问名称的计算有明确的规范,涉及多个步骤。
- 在Chromium开发者工具中,可以查看可访问名称的计算步骤和顺序。
- 如果设置了冲突的可访问名称定义方式,最终的可访问名称将遵循计算规范。
❓
延伸问答
什么是可访问名称,它的作用是什么?
可访问名称为辅助技术用户提供元素的上下文和目的,例如告诉屏幕阅读器用户按钮的功能。
如何检查网页元素的可访问名称?
可以通过浏览器的开发者工具查看元素的可访问名称信息。
哪些元素必须具有可访问名称?
所有可聚焦的交互元素,如链接、按钮、对话框和某些结构容器,都必须具有可访问名称。
可访问名称是如何计算的?
可访问名称的计算遵循明确的规范,涉及多个步骤,具体顺序可以在Chromium开发者工具中查看。
如果设置了冲突的可访问名称定义方式,会发生什么?
最终的可访问名称将遵循计算规范,通常以aria-labelledby的内容为准。
有哪些资源可以帮助了解可访问名称的更多信息?
可以参考《可访问名称和描述计算 1.2》规范和《可访问名称指导》文档。
➡️